Best Answer

Formal disapproval of the actions of a member of Congress by the other members is known as censure. this is a motion that can be presented by any member of the Congress to be debated by the others.

Why did some Clinton supporters want to censure him during him during his impeachment?

A censure is an official statement of disapproval but does not result in removal from office or other punishment. Clinton supporters would favor a censure as a possible substitute for impeachment.
